Gather round, we’re going back to the earliest days of Nike’s skateboarding division, Nike SB. It was the early 2000s and skating was, yet again, sweeping the nation. There was a Pac Sun in every mall and a three-stair in front of every garage. Footwear giant Nike wanted in on some of that sweet skater cash and they launched Nike SB in March of 2002.

One of the first skaters on the lineup was renowned Ollie master, Reese Forbes. Forbes’ signature shoe was a low top version of the classic Nike Dunk, but done in two tone denim and cut so that the edges of the fabric would fray up with skating. It was a guaranteed star shoe, but Forbes had second thoughts–he jumped ship at Nike for Quiksilver and only 444 pairs were ever made. Those are some of the most collectible pairs on eBay to this day.

Now, fifteen years later, Nike has rereleased the Forbes shoe in a high top while keeping the red accent sole. Tear up a pair before it’s too late for $110 at Nike.
